    A convolution theorem for the Poisson transform on compactly supported distributions is obtained. Applying the convolution theorem, the Poisson transform is extended as a linear continuous map from a suitable Boehmian space into another Boehmian space satisfying the convolution theorem. The introduction of Boehmian spaces by \textit{P.\,Mikusinski} [Jap.\ J.\ Math., New Ser.\ 9, 159--179 (1983; Zbl 0524.44005)] opened a new avenue in extending integral transforms. The construction of an abstract Boehmian space was given in [loc.\,cit.] with two notions of convergence. Later, various Boehmian spaces have been defined, and also various integral transforms have been extended to them [see, e.g., \textit{R.\,Roopkumar}, Bull.\ Inst.\ Math., Acad.\ Sin.\ (N.\,S.) 4, No.\,1, 75--96 (2009; Zbl 1182.46030)].
